What is the term for an estimate of the standard deviation of the sampling distribution of a statistic?

Explanation:
The main idea here is the standard error. It is the estimate of the standard deviation of the sampling distribution of a statistic, such as the sample mean. This tells you how much the statistic would vary if you repeated the study many times with different samples. It’s different from the standard deviation, which measures how spread out the individual data points are within one sample. Confidence intervals use the standard error to describe a range for the population parameter, and the margin of error is the half-width of that interval, not the variability of the statistic itself. So the term that fits is standard error.
